What does Invisalign look like?
Invisalign aligners are clear, custom-made plastic trays that fit over the teeth. They are virtually invisible when worn, making them discreet and popular among patients of all ages.
How many Invisalign trays is average?
The average number of Invisalign trays for treatment can vary depending on the severity of misalignment, with minor cases typically requiring around one year or less of treatment, while more severe cases may need a series of aligners that could take up to 24 months to complete.
How many days per tray with Invisalign?
The number of days per tray with Invisalign typically ranges from 7 to 14 days, depending on the treatment plan and the orthodontist's recommendations. It's essential to follow the specific instructions provided by your orthodontist for optimal results.

Will Invisalign damage my teeth?
Invisalign aligners do not damage teeth when used as directed by a professional. They are designed to gently move teeth into the desired position without causing harm. Regular dental check-ups during treatment ensure teeth remain healthy throughout the process.

How many hours per day should I wear Invisalign?
Patients should wear Invisalign aligners for at least 20 to 22 hours per day to ensure effective treatment and optimal results. It is essential to wear them consistently to achieve the desired outcome within the expected timeframe.
How often should Invisalign be worn?
Invisalign aligners should be worn for at least 22 hours a day, removing them only for eating, drinking (except water), brushing, and flossing. Consistency in wearing the aligners is crucial for effective treatment and achieving desired results.
Can Invisalign correct bite issues?
Invisalign can correct mild to moderate bite issues, such as overbites, underbites, and crossbites. Severe cases may require traditional braces. Consult with an orthodontist to determine the best treatment for your specific bite concern.
What is Invisaligns success rate?
Invisalign has a high success rate, with many patients achieving desired results. Compliance with wearing aligners as instructed and following oral hygiene practices are key factors in the treatment's success. Regular check-ups with orthodontists help monitor progress and ensure optimal outcomes.
Are Invisalign results permanent?
Invisalign results can be permanent with proper post-treatment care, including wearing retainers as instructed by your orthodontist. Consistent retainer use helps maintain the alignment achieved by the Invisalign treatment, ensuring long-lasting results.
Does Invisalign affect speech?
Invisalign may temporarily affect speech as the mouth adjusts to the aligners. Speech typically improves as the tongue and mouth muscles adapt to the aligners. Regular practice and speaking aloud can help overcome any initial speech changes.
How to clean Invisalign trays?
To clean Invisalign trays, brush them gently with a toothbrush and rinse in lukewarm water. Avoid using hot water as it can damage the trays. Soak the aligners in a denture cleaner or Invisalign cleaning crystals regularly to keep them fresh and clear.

Does Invisalign include a retainer?
Yes, Invisalign treatment typically includes a retainer to maintain the results achieved with the aligners. Retainers are custom-made to fit your teeth after completing the Invisalign treatment to prevent teeth from shifting back to their original position.
Can Invisalign fix crowded teeth?
Yes, Invisalign can fix crowded teeth by gradually shifting them into the correct position using custom aligners. The treatment duration varies based on the severity of crowding, with minor cases potentially requiring as little as one year and more severe cases up to 24 months for alignment.
How to store Invisalign while eating?
When eating, store Invisalign aligners in the case provided. Avoid wrapping them in napkins or placing them on a table to prevent loss or damage. Always keep the aligners in their case to maintain hygiene and prevent misplacement.
Do Invisalign aligners contain BPA?
Invisalign aligners do not contain BPA. They are made of a patented thermoplastic material called SmartTrack, which is free from BPA and phthalates, making them safe for use in orthodontic treatment.

Can Invisalign cause gum recession?
Invisalign aligners do not directly cause gum recession. However, poor oral hygiene during treatment can lead to gum issues. It's crucial to maintain good dental care habits to prevent any potential gum problems while using Invisalign aligners.
How does Invisalign compare to Veneers?
Invisalign is a teeth straightening treatment, while veneers are used to improve the appearance of teeth by covering them. Invisalign is removable, discreet, and comfortable, focusing on alignment correction, while veneers are a cosmetic solution for tooth appearance.

How to manage discomfort with Invisalign?
To manage discomfort with Invisalign, consider using orthodontic wax on any areas causing irritation, take over-the-counter pain relievers as needed, stick to a soft diet initially, and follow proper oral hygiene practices to prevent additional discomfort.
Can you whiten teeth with Invisalign?
While Invisalign aligners can straighten teeth, they do not whiten teeth. Teeth whitening treatments are separate procedures that can be discussed with your orthodontist for a brighter smile alongside Invisalign treatment.
Does Invisalign require dental impressions?
Invisalign treatment does not require traditional dental impressions. Instead, it relies on laser, three-dimensional scanning to create custom aligners for patients, making the process more comfortable and convenient.
